Vermelho by Christian Louboutin: Hotel Spotlight

In a small village in Portugal lives Christian Louboutin’s first hotel: Vermelho. A hotel that encapsulates La Vie en Rouge and a medley of European references and artistry – from it’s surrounding Portuguese influence within the village of Melides to Louboutin’s French and Egyptian heritage influences to Italian sculpture and artistry.
